Wahl Name Meaning. German and Jewish (Ashkenazic): from Middle High German Walhe, Walch 'foreigner from a Romance country', hence a nickname for someone from Italy or France, etc. This surname is also established in Sweden. North German: from the personal name Wole, a short form of Wol(d)er (see Wahler).

Viraj, this word in Sanskrit language, indicates sovereignty, excellence or splendour. Viraj is the mythical primeval being associated with creation who is often personified as the secondary creator. Viraj is born from Purusha and Purusha in turn is born from Viraj. ... Viraj is also the name of a metre.
A tulou (simplified Chinese: 土楼; traditional Chinese: 土樓; pinyin: tǔlóu; Pe̍h-ōe-jī: thó͘-lâu), or "earthen building", is a traditional communal Hakka people residence found in Fujian, in South China, usually of a circular configuration surrounding a central shrine, and part of Hakka architecture.
